Here at Incarnation we have one Kindergarten teacher, Ms.Margaret Wilson and a Kindergarten Aid, Mrs. Luanne Gilman.   In kindergarten at Incarnation we strive to take children from where they are developmentally and provide hands-on experiences to challenge them as they grow.

The classroom experience is a balance of whole group, small group and individual activities for each child.  There are quiet times of listening and times of active exploration provided through both learning and play centers.  Learning materials are planned based on the child’s prior knowledge, interests and teacher determination.  In this developmentally appropriate environment, the materials used, methods of instruction and hands-on activities are aligned with the level of development of each child.  In the kindergarten classroom, we view education as a holistic approach to teaching by striving to fulfill the needs of the mind, body and soul of each child.  We love and nurture each child as a unique individual of a loving God.

Our integrated curriculum includes a strong phonics based language arts program, a math program based on real world concepts and science and social studies programs based on observation and analysis of the natural world.  Our kindergarten religion program emphasizes Christianity as the basis of a healthy society.  Through Bible stories, prayers, songs and attending Mass, students learn to exemplify truth, honor, self-discipline and model the heart of Jesus Christ with compassion and respect for others and themselves.  To further enhance the kindergarten curriculum, the students participate in classes such as Spanish, Art, Music, Computer, P.E. and Library.
